‘We commend his bravery’: Dragons issue Blacklock apology – Sydney Morning Herald
One of the club’s most recognisable stars said he was driven away from the Dragons due to racism. The club has swiftly responded.

“Everyone at the club were saddened to read over the weekend that racism played a contributing role in Nathan’s departure from the club in the early-2000s, and commend his bravery in speaking out.
“We have come a long way as a club with addressing matters pertinent to not only players of Indigenous background but across all cultures.”
Racism has no place in society, in rugby league and certainly not at the St George Illawarra Dragons
